Output ae26d0ccd81aeb02d9417b724c16e9aaaff93f56d3df212795ef5a4aba45e28a:1

value
32371670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64308d0b25a66601d1416525d8bcdcc1ecb46c5e OP_EQUAL
address
3Apmf76xDAnFZVL3Z26wotii82JEduMvGr
transaction
ae26d0ccd81aeb02d9417b724c16e9aaaff93f56d3df212795ef5a4aba45e28a
spent
true